Guest guest Posted October 2, 2008 Report Share Posted October 2, 2008 Hi Sheila and all, can I have some help with interpreting my latest results. I'll start with my old result for some background information. Results from 19/03/08 T4 105 (ref 58-150), TSH 5.99 (0.4- 4.0). FT4 14.0 (10-22), FT3 6.85 (2.8-6.5), FT4: FT3 Ratio 2.04 (3.0-5), thyroglobulin anti bodies <20 (0-40), TPOab 629 (0-35) 24 hour adrenal salivery test 04/04/08 at Stage 5 7-8 am 9 (13-24) 11-noon 3 (5-8) 4-5 pm 1 (3-8) 11-midnight 2 (1-4) DHEA 5 (3-10) Results from 20/5/08 T4 77 (ref 58-150), TSH 5.51 (0.4- 4.0). FT4 15.60 (10-22), FT3 5.99 (2.8-6.5), FT4: FT3 Ratio 2.60 (3.0-5), thyroglobulin anti bodies <20.3 (0-40), TPOab 426 (0-35) Supplements, whole liquorice root (capsules), zinc, selenium, magnesium. Vitamins, C, B6, B12. 27/06/08 Started on 25mg levothyroxine. (Trial) Levothyroxine increased to 50 mg Latest results Results from 23/09/08 T4 128 (ref 58-150), TSH 5.37 (0.4- 4.0). FT4 19.9 (10-22), FT3 7.79 (2.8-6.5), FT4: FT3 Ratio 2.55 (3.0-5), thyroglobulin anti bodies <20.0 (0-40), TPOab 549 (0-35) Reverse T3 0.44 (0.14-0.54) Although I'm still hypo I can see that my T4 and FT4 have improved from my last test, what I find confusing is the high FT3 and high TSH. Could this be pointing to stacking of the FT3 due to my adrenals still being to low, I hoped they would improve with the liquorice and other supplements, is the next step HC supplement?
